Connect Appointments is recruiting an Assistant Warehouse Manager to join an established retail distribution business based in Livingston on a full‑time permanent basis. Our client operates a large, busy distribution centre in Livingston, offering a back shift position with a competitive salary and a clear operational remit from day one.
What's on offer?
- Full‑time permanent position
- Monday to Friday, 11am to 9pm
- £32,000 to £34,000 per annum (dependent on experience)
As an Assistant Warehouse Manager, your duties will include:
- Supporting the day‑to‑day management of the distribution centre and warehouse operative team
- Maintaining high standards of health, safety, productivity and timekeeping across the site
- Ensuring work is allocated, completed and reported accurately within required timescales
- Assisting with training, mentoring and the development of a multiskilled workforce
- Supporting grievance meetings, return to work interviews and disciplinary processes
- Managing consumables ordering and maintaining appropriate inventory levels
- Implementing procedures and responding quickly to operational change
To be considered as an Assistant Warehouse Manager, you will need:
- Previous experience in a warehouse management or supervisory role within a large, fast‑paced distribution environment
- Strong knowledge of warehouse operations including stock and inventory processes
- Proven ability to lead, motivate and manage a team effectively
- Excellent communication skills with experience engaging a range of stakeholders
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office and experience using warehouse management systems
- Experience in retail or FMCG distribution is advantageous
